Output 4b21c72aef627224a5106385a94133b2389e98dc26a5c25679144095c9067446:0

value
20523712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35378e1d53a72e4d46593ed29243fc742fef0c94 OP_EQUAL
address
36YQHkQcjisW4979EhcV9c9Tqy8tGVK3ZY
transaction
4b21c72aef627224a5106385a94133b2389e98dc26a5c25679144095c9067446
spent
true